WebDec 20, 2024 · Room and board, if the student is enrolled on at least a half-time basis When Do Families Use 529 Plans for Graduate or Professional School? Most often, a 529 plan is used to pay for graduate or professional school when there is leftover money from the beneficiary’s undergraduate education. WebAug 21, 2024 · Room and Board. College students who live in residence halls or other housing run by the school can use 529 funds to pay the cost of their dorm room and school meal plan. Students who decide to live in an apartment off-campus also can use education funds to pay their rent and living expenses.
